1. Gaunt B'Ham is 1973 onwards - Welch Regt had an active service end date of 1969 so this badge is an unofficial commission or possible cadet issue if indeed they actually wore them.

2. Smith & Wright looks good but I would have expected to see the slider slightly more tapered. If you have some digital calipers can you measure the width of the top of the slider (near the bend) and near the 'point' for me and post them here.

The gold back denotes the final dye colour used in the anodising process - nothing more so don't get hung about this sort of thing.

3. Looks like a rare fake as opposed to an unofficial commission. If you decide to sell it please let me know first as if it is a fake item (I need to handle it first) I would like to include it in my book.

It's not a "Famous Regiments" issue as these all had pointed lugs.
